Transaction 577f1a7b63d2a816a2634224bcb469d32ef0651e690bd4cabd7c48bc84b5075f
1 Input
1 Output
-
577f1a7b63d2a816a2634224bcb469d32ef0651e690bd4cabd7c48bc84b5075f:0
- value
- 52366739
- script pubkey
- OP_0 OP_PUSHBYTES_20 a03e488cf90e4c619fc88c436ef4bf0cd01dbab4
- address
- bc1q5qly3r8epexxr87g33pkaa9lpngpmw45nxvkq7